Wiener Neustadt, Österreich - In Vienna, a current charges caused a stir due to a thwarted terrorist attack. The public prosecutor has accused an 18-year-old in connection with a planned assassination attempt on a Taylor-Swift-concert in the summer of 2024. The circumstances are explosive, because the accused now has to answer to the Wiener Neustadt regional court.

The allegations are serious: membership in a terrorist association and criminal organization. Already at the age of 15, the young man converted to Islam and began to deal intensively with the radical Islamic teachings of IS. He frequented mosques, which are known as the places of extremism, and glorified the actions of the Vienna assassin Kujtim F. In the past, the accused was also convicted of serious bodily harm.

planned attacks on crowds

In August 2024 there was a drastic turn: The defendant was arrested on August 7 together with another suspect, Beran A.. This 19-year-old, who has North Macedonian roots, confessed to killing a "large crowd" and planned the use of explosives and stabbing in the area of ​​the Ernst Happel Stadium, which was intended as an event location for the concert. According to the information from Kleine Zeitung , the risk was recognized by information from international secret services.

The accused claims to have been ignorant about the self -made explosives. Interestingly, he and Beran A. are known from school and spent a lot of time together in 2024. The accused was even in the car when his accomplice tested a blue light and a follow -up tone horn that was intended for the implementation of the crime. This raises further questions about the role of the 18-year-old in this planned terrorist attack.

concerns about radicalization

The background to the radicalization of young people are complex. According to studies, such as bpb , play personal living conditions, social isolation and the Internet an important role. An increased risk of terrorism is also noticeable in Austria, especially after recent incidents such as the Hamas attacks on Israel, which raise the terrorist warning level to four. Nevertheless, Interior Minister Gerhard Karner said that the immediate threat situation had been minimized.
